However, a coffee table with a copper top can not only serve as a functional surface for drinks and snacks but also as a stunning centerpiece in your living room. The warm tones of copper add an element of elegance and sophistication, making it a versatile choice for various design styles, from modern to rustic. Copper is known for its unique patina that develops over time, allowing each table to tell its own story. Whether you’re hosting a gathering or enjoying a quiet evening at home, a copper-topped coffee table can enhance your space in many ways. One of the benefits of a copper top is its durability. Copper is naturally resistant to bacteria and easy to clean, which makes it ideal for a frequently used surface. You can easily wipe it down with a soft cloth and mild cleaner to keep it looking pristine. Additionally, copper is a great conductor of heat, which can be beneficial if you often serve hot beverages or dishes. However, it’s essential to take care of your copper top to maintain its shine. Regular polishing can prevent tarnishing and keep it looking as good as new. In terms of design, copper-topped coffee tables come in various styles and shapes. You can find round, square, and rectangular options, allowing you to choose one that fits your space perfectly. Pair a copper top with a wood or metal base to create a striking contrast. For a more eclectic look, consider mixing materials and textures. For example, a copper top with a reclaimed wood base can add a rustic charm to your living room. When selecting decor for your copper table, consider using neutral tones to allow the table to shine as the focal point. Simple decorative trays, candles, or even a floral arrangement can beautifully complement the copper without overwhelming it. Additionally, incorporating other metallic elements in the room can create a cohesive look. Think about using copper accents in light fixtures or picture frames to tie everything together.
